JavaScript中Document对象常见的的属性分析

JavaScript中Document对象常见的属性分析:DOM的“总管家”详解

引言:Document对象,网页的“核心枢纽”

在JavaScript中,Document对象是DOM(Document Object Model,文档对象模型)的根节点,代表整个HTML/XML文档。它像网页的“总管家”,提供访问、修改和操作文档元素的接口。2026年,随着WebAssembly和PWA(Progressive Web App)的普及,Document属性仍是前端开发的基石——据MDN报告,80%以上的JS交互依赖Document。常见属性如titlebodycookie等,不仅用于动态更新页面,还支持事件监听和表单验证。本文剖析10大高频属性(基于W3C标准与Chrome 120+兼容性),从定义、作用到实战代码,按功能分类。目标:掌握后,你能轻松构建响应式UI,提升代码可维护性。预计阅读时长:15分钟。准备浏览器控制台?立即实验!

核心属性速览:功能分类表格

Document属性多样,按“文档元数据”、“结构元素”、“交互状态”分类。以下表格汇总关键信息(数据源:MDN Web Docs,兼容性>95%):

分类属性名称类型/返回值主要作用兼容性(浏览器)示例场景
文档元数据titlestring获取/设置页面标题全支持SEO优化/动态标题更新
文档元数据URLstring当前文档URL(全路径)全支持路由跳转/日志记录
文档元数据referrerstring来源页面URL(空则无)全支持防盗链/来源统计
文档元数据cookiestring获取/设置Cookie字符串全支持用户会话/状态持久化
结构元素headHTMLHeadElement元素引用全支持动态添加/
文章已创建 4944

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

相关文章

开始在上面输入您的搜索词,然后按回车进行搜索。按ESC取消。

返回顶部